Seven different lecturers are to deliver lectures in seven perday. A, B and C are three oftne lectures. The number of ways in which a routine for theday canr be made such that A delivers his lecture before B and B before C, is

A

420

B

120

C

210

D

none of these

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

Let us consider the arrangements of 7 objects out of which three are identical and remaining distinct. In each arrangement of these 7 objects, let us mark the first identical item as P, second as Q and third as R. We find that in all the `(7!)/(3!)` arrangements P will occur prior to Q and Q will occur prior to R.
In the given sum also the required number of ways `=(7!)/(3!)=840`
